What is Secondary Glazing?

Secondary glazing describes the installation of a second layer of glazing (typically a clear acrylic or glass panel) to the within or outside of existing windows. This system acts as an extra barrier to outdoor temperatures, noise contamination, and air infiltration, making homes more comfortable and decreasing energy expenses.

Installation Techniques

The installation of secondary glazing can vary based upon window type and individual choice. Here are some typical installation methods:

  1. Magnetically Mounted Panels: These panels are lightweight and connect utilizing magnetic strips. They are easily removable for cleansing and storage.

  2. Hinged Panels: This technique makes use of a hinged frame that allows the panel to swing open, permitting for easy access to the original windows.

  3. Moving Panels: These panels move open and closed, comparable to a traditional moving door. They are ideal for large openings where ease of access is required.

  4. Repaired Panels: These panels are permanently connected and offer efficient noise and thermal insulation but do not enable access to initial windows.

Each approach has its advantages and can be picked based upon specific needs, window types, and aesthetic preferences.

Cost Considerations

The cost of secondary glazing can differ widely based on materials, window specs, and installation complexity. Below is a rough overview of costs connected with various kinds of Secondary Glazing Plastic Options glazing:

Type of Secondary GlazingApproximate Cost per Square Foot
Acrylic Panels₤ 10 - ₤ 20
Glass Panels₤ 15 - ₤ 30
Professional Installation₤ 5 - ₤ 15

Elements Influencing Costs

  1. Product Quality: Higher-quality materials such as double-strength glass will increase the total cost.

  2. Window Size: Larger windows will naturally sustain greater costs for materials and installation.

  3. Design Complexity: Unique or custom installations may demand extra labor expenses.

  4. Installation Needs: DIY setups can conserve money, but professional installers guarantee appropriate application and efficiency.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)

1. What is the difference in between secondary glazing and double glazing?

Secondary glazing involves including an additional layer to existing windows, while double glazing consists of two layers of glass manufactured specifically as a single system.

2. Can I set up secondary glazing myself?

Yes, lots of secondary glazing options are designed for DIY installation. Nevertheless, professional installation is advised for complex designs or if you are unsure about the process.

3. Will secondary glazing affect the appearance of my home?

Secondary glazing panels are developed to be discrete and can frequently blend perfectly with existing windows, maintaining the home's visual appeals.

4. Is secondary glazing reliable in older homes?

Yes. Secondary glazing is especially advantageous for older homes, as it boosts energy efficiency without altering the character of historic windows.

5. How much can I save on energy costs with secondary glazing?

While savings might differ, many property owners report a reduction of up to 15-20% in energy costs, especially throughout colder months.
